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Type: Different types of windows (e.g., double-hung, casement, bay) have varying costs due to materials and complexity.
- Material: The choice between vinyl, wood, aluminum, or fiberglass can significantly impact the price.
- Size: Larger windows require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Energy Efficiency: Windows with advanced energy-efficient features generally cost more upfront but can save money in the long run.
- Installation Complexity: The complexity of the installation, such as the need for structural modifications, can add to the c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Lebanon, OH can influence the overall cost of installation.
- Permits and Inspections: Costs associated with obtaining necessary permits and inspections can vary.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ost Range ($) |
---|---|
Standard Double-Hung Window | 300 - 700 |
Casement Window | 400 - 800 |
Bay Window Installation | 1,200 - 3,000 |
Energy-Efficient Window Upgrade | 500 - 1,200 |
Labor Cost per Window | 100 - 300 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| 50 - 150 |
Window Frame Repair | 100 - 400 |
Full Window Replacement (per window) | 600 - 1,500 |
